After being defeated in Molten Core, Ragnaros was banished back to the Elemental Plane. He is now located in Sulfuron Keep, his seat of power within the Firelands. He and his armies will be launching a full scale assault on Mount Hyjal, attempting to burn the now-regrowing World Tree. It seems that he has allied with Deathwing, therefore ending his war against Neferian’s forces, and uniting them as a single army. He would be one of two Elemental Lords allied with Deathwing, the other being Al’Akir. His assault on World Tree is run by several of his lieutenants (notably Baron Geddon) assisted by troops of the Twilight’s Hammer clan and various members of Twilight dragonflight. According to a series of quests in Mount Hyjal, the assault of Ragnaros was repulsed with the help of some recently revived Eternals and Guardians of Hyjal.
Ragnaros, lord of the Firelands, embodies the fury and destruction of the primordial infernos that forged Azeroth itself. Promised the chance to set Azeroth aflame without interference from Neptulon and Therazane, Ragnaros seeks to appease the Old Godsby incinerating the World Tree of Nordrassil.

Stage 1: By Fire be Purged!
Boss Abilities
-
Sulfuras Smash: Ragnaros faces a random player and prepares to smashes Sulfuras on the platform. The impact creates several Lava Waves which move out in several directions from the point of impact.
-
Lava Wave: A Lava Wave inflicts 73,542 Fire damage and knocks back all players it passes through. Targets who are knocked back suffer an additional 21,012 Fire damage every 1 sec for 5 sec.
-
Wrath of Ragnaros: Ragnaros targets a player, inflicting 63,036 Fire damage to all players within 6 yards and knocking them back.
-
Hand of Ragnaros: Ragnaros inclits 31,518 Fire damage to all enemies within 50 yards, knocking them back.
-
Magma Trap: Ragnaros periodically forms a Magma Trap at a random player’s location. The Magma Trap persists for the duration of the battle and will trigger when stepped on, causing a Magma Trap Erutpion.
-
Magma Trap Eruption: When triggered, a Magma Trap erupts for 63,036 Fire damage to all enemies within the Firelands, and violently knocking the player who tripped the Magma Trap into the air.
Intermission: Minions of Fire!
At 70% health, Ragnaros will cast Splitting Blow, wedging Sulfuras into the platform and creating Sons of Flame accross the platform. Ragnaros will stay submerged for 45 seconds or until all of the Sons of Flame are destroyed.
-
Splitting Blow: Ragnaros buries Sulfuras within the platform, creating Sons of Flame that attempt to reach the mighty hammer.
-
Burning Speed: Sons of Flame move faster as their blaze burns hotter. Their movement speed is increased by an amount equal to every 1% health they have above 50% health.
-
Supernova: If a Son of Flame reaches Sulfuras, the elemental will explode in a Supernova, inflicting 94,554 Fire damage to all players within the Firelands.
Stage 2: Sulfuras will be Your End!
Boss Abilities
Molten Seed
Ragnaros forms a Molten Seed at the location of 10 random players, inflicting 57,783 Fire damage to all players within 6 yards. After 10 sec the Molten Seed will burst in a Molten Inferno.
Intermission: Denizens of Flame
At 40% health, Ragnaros will cast Splitting Blow, wedging Sulfuras into the platform and creating Sons of Flame accross the platform. Ragnaros will stay submerged for 45 seconds or until all of the Sons of Flame are destroyed.
-
Splitting Blow: Ragnaros buries Sulfuras within the platform, creating Sons of Flame that attempt to reach the mighty hammer.
Sons of Flame
Sons of Flame will cross the platform and attempt to re-form with Sulfuras, causing a Supernova if they are able to reach the mighty weapon.
-
Burning Speed: Sons of Flame move faster as their blaze burns hotter. Their movement speed is increased by an amount equal to every 1% health they have above 50% health.
-
Supernova: If a Son of Flame reaches Sulfuras, the elemental will explode in a Supernova, inflicting 94,554 Fire damage to all players within the Firelands.
-
Lava Scion: One Lava Scion will form on each side of the platform.
-
Blazing Heat: The Lava Scion inflicts a random target with Blazing Heat, causing them to create a trail of Blazing Heat in their wake. Blazing Heat inflicts 52,530 Fire damage every 1 sec. and heals Sons of Flame and Lava Scion for 10% every 1 sec.
Stage 3: Be Gone From My Realm!
-
Sulfuras Smash: Ragnaros faces a random player and prepares to smashes Sulfuras on the platform. The impact creates several Lava Waves which move out in several directions from the point of impact.
-
Lava Wave: A Lava Wave inflicts 73,542 Fire damage and knocks back all players it passes through. Targets who are knocked back suffer an additional 21,012 Fire damage every 1 sec for 5 sec.
-
Engulfing Flames: Ragnaros periodically engulfs one third of the platform in flame, inflicting 73,542 Fire damage to players caught in the conflagration.
-
Summon Living Meteor: Ragnaros calls down an increasing number of Living Meteors over time, inflicting 68,289 Fire damage to players within 5 yards of the location.
-
Living Meteor: The Living Meteor will fixate on a random target and chase them. A player that gets within 4 yards of the Living Meteor will trigger a Meteor Impact, inflicting 525,300 Fire damage to enemies within 8 yards.
-
Meteor Impact: A player that gets within 4 yards of the Living Meteor will trigger a Meteor Impact, inflicting 525,300 Fire damage to enemies within 8 yards.
-
Combustible: The Living Meteor is highly Combustible. When attacked, it will cause Combustion, knocking it back several yards away from the enemy that hit it. Combustible is removed for several seconds after Combustion is triggered.
-
Combustion: While Combustible is active, the Living Meteor is knocked back several yards from the enemy that hit it.
Stage 4: The True Power of the Fire Lord! (Heroic Only)
The Fire lord unleashes his full power and is able to move freely around the platform. Players have the aid of powerful heroes of Azeroth to support them.
Boss Abilities
-
Superheated: Ragnaros is at his full power and is not Superheated, inflicting 2,101 Fire damage every 1 second, increasing damage taken from Superheated by 10%. Stacks.
-
Empower Sulfuras: Ragnaros beings to empower Sulfuras. After 5 sec, Sulfuras becomes Empowered and attacks made by Ragnaros cause Flames of Sulfruas, inflicting 525,300 damage to all enemies within the Firelands.
-
Flames of Sulfuras: When Sulfuras is Empowered, attacks made by Ragnaros cause Flames of Sulfuras, inflicting 525,300 Fire damage to all enemies within the Firelands.
-
Dreadflame: Sulfuras creates a Dreadflame at two nearby locations. The Dreadflame multiplies rapidly and spreads across the platform. Dreadflame inflicts 36,771 Fire damage and an additional 3,677 Fire damage every 1 sec for 30 sec.
-
Magma Geyser: Ragnaros will target a Magma Geser whenever he notices four players in a cluster together. The Magma Geyser inflicts 57,783 Fire damage every 1 sec and destroys any nearby Breadth of Frost.
Cenarius
Cenarius is a demigod, the son of Malorne and Elune, and the patron of all of Azeroth’s druids. Cenarius will support the raid by freezing Living Meteors and reducing the damage caused by Superheated.
-
Breadth of Frost: Cenarius forms a Breadth of Frost at a nearby location. Any Living Meteors that enter the Breadth of Frost are Frozen and take 15,000% additional damage. Additionally, players who stand within the Breadth of Frost are immune to Superheated damage and have the Superheated debuff removed from them.
Arch Druid Hamuul Runetotem
Hamuul Runetotem is a tauren druid and leads the druids of Thunder Bluff. In Mount Hyjal, he assists Ysera in protecting Nordrassil from Ragnaros. The arch druid will support the raid by entrapping Ragnaros.
-
Entrapping Roots: Arch Druid Hamuul Runetotem forms Entrapping Roots at a nearby location. If Ragnaros enters the area of the Entrapping Roots, he will become stunned for 10 sec and take 50% extra damage while stunned.
Malfurion Stormrage
Malfurion Stormrage is an ancient and powerful night elf druid. He leads the army of Cenarius in the Defense of Mount Hyjal against the forces of Ragnaros. Malfurion will support the raid by protecting players from Dreadflame.
-
Cloudburst: Malfurion forms a Cloudburst. The players who interact with the Cloudburst will be surrounded with a Deluge. Deluge makes the player immune to Dreadflame damage, and also allows the player to extinguish nearby Dreadflame.
-
Deluge: Makes the player immune to Dreadflame damage, and also allows the player to extinguish any nearby Dreadflame.
